Here's a patch for the problem. As stated in the linked forum entry, the problem is
using String.getBytes() and creating a ByteArrayInputStream prior to validating the
schema.
The solution is to use a Reader and an InputSource which respect the given encoding of the
String because they both work on characters and not on bytes.
